HIGH SCHOOL COLLEGE AND CAREER FAIRS SCHEDULED


Collier County Public Schools (CCPS) high school students will have a chance to research and explore different colleges and careers by attending their school’s High School College and Career Fair in February, March, or May.
CCPS’s Office of Career and Technical Education, together with the high schools’ career counselors, coordinate these fairs to broaden students’ exposure to the career and educational opportunities available to them.  Students will explore job openings or potential internships that may be offered at local businesses such as Arthrex, Century Link, Florida Department of Children and Families, NCH Healthcare System, Physicians Regional Healthcare, Publix Supermarket, and many more!  Representatives from local colleges and universities including Barry, DeVry, Florida Gulf Coast, Full Sail, Hodges, Immokalee Technical Center, ITT Technical Institute, Johnson and Wales University, Keiser, Lorenzo Walker Technical Center, NOVA, Rasmussen, Southwest Florida College, The Art Institutes, Universal Technical, and Weber University will be available.  Military branches will also be present.
The fairs are usually held from Noon to 2 p.m.  Times may vary at some schools – please contact the school for details.

Parents! Weather Channel Bad Weather!

 

When bad weather threatens to affect the operation of our school, you can get the latest and most official information direct from the school district office by calling the INFORMATION HOTLINE at 1-888-994-NEWS (1-888-994-6397).  Messages there are available in English, Spanish and Creole.  Go online to the home page of the district's Web site - www.collierschools.com., or watch THE EDUCATION CHANNEL, cable 99.

Collier County School Board encourages all parents to educate their children about being "Internet Smart." They are recommending that parents check out the Internet safety site called NetSmartz®. "NetSmartz® is an interactive, educational safety resource from the National Center for Missing & Exploited Children® and Boys & Girls Clubs of America for children (ages 5-17), parents, guardians, educators, and law enforcement that uses age-appropriate, 3-D activities to teach children how to stay safer on the Internet. The NetSmartz Workshop can be accessed at www.NetSmartz.org and www.NetSmartzKids.org."
